WebAug 22, 2024 · Currently, there is limited research into triggers of childhood migraine. The aim of this study is to identify trigger in young patients with migraine. There have only been five studies, two in France, two in India and one in Brazil, published to identify triggers of migraine in children [3-7]. Stress and warm climate were reported in all 5 ...

WebAug 15, 2024 · Physical exertion can trigger childhood migraine. Some migraineurs report that they are more likely to develop a headache after participating in sports or being extremely active. Minor head trauma (eg, being hit in the head with a ball, falling on one's head) may result in exacerbations of migraine lasting from days to months. These can include: Abdominal migraine. Benign … downhill demo 10WebAbdominal migraine is a condition that causes episodes of moderate to severe abdominal (belly) pain lasting one to 72 hours. The condition is related to migraine headache, but doesn’t cause head pain. Children are most likely to experience abdominal migraine.
